'Love Is Stronger Than Cancer': Musician Copes Online With Chemo

Harry Hudson was just a Los Angeles-based recording artist in the midst of an up-and-coming music career. The 20-year-old musician released his debut album , followed by a music video for his single, "World Is Gone."
But Hudson's life changed drastically when he was diagnosed with Hodgkin's lymphoma, a type of cancer originating from white blood cells.
Despite this enormous challenge, Hudson's kept a level head by documenting his fight on Twitter and Instagram.
His words and photos are not only inspiring examples of perseverance and positive thinking, but a way for him to cope. Hudson told  that he relied on social media for support when he was feeling alone in his illness.
"I realized that there were thousands of young adults living with cancer who are just like me," he said. "So I turned to social media to reach out to those who I couldn't physically be there to help. If I could inspire one person to live their life to the fullest, then I accomplished what I set out to do."
